Vin + Omi Collaborate with Prince Charles for Eco-Friendly Fashion at London Fashion Week

Vin + Omi, the sustainable fashion brand known for their unique approach to design, has joined forces with an unexpected partner for their upcoming collection debut at London Fashion Week in September. None other than Prince Charles, the future monarch of the UK, has had a hand in creating this eco-friendly range. Utilizing materials sourced from nettles found on the prince’s very own Highgrove estate, the collection will be unveiled at the exclusive Sting at The Savoy event in partnership with the hotel’s sustainability program.

The textile used in the creation of these dresses has been described by the designers as having a luxurious feel, similar to that of alpaca or cashmere. The collaboration between Vin + Omi and Prince Charles blossomed from a conversation at a Positive Fashion Initiative event last year, where the concept of incorporating nettles into clothing was first floated. This led to an invitation for the designers to visit Highgrove, where they were able to gather 3,000 nettles to be transformed into a fabric boasting a delicate, ethereal quality.

Vin + Omi, celebrated for their avant-garde style, were pleasantly surprised to be welcomed into the prestigious setting of Highgrove, given their punk-inspired roots. The decision to utilize nettles as a primary material is not only a bold fashion statement, but also a testament to the brand’s dedication to promoting sustainability and ecological awareness within the industry. By repurposing a natural waste product like nettles, the designers aim to ignite conversations about the importance of adopting more environmentally conscious practices in fashion.

Backed by the support and active involvement of Prince Charles himself, the collaborative project is poised to make waves at London Fashion Week. The esteemed V&A museum in London has already expressed interest in acquiring a piece from this groundbreaking collection for their archives, acknowledging the exceptional significance of this partnership and the innovative use of materials in the realm of fashion.
